Python提供了多种内置的数据结构,这些数据结构在编程中非常有用。那么Python常见数据结构有哪些?主要包括列表、元组、集合、字典等,接下来是具体内容介绍。
1、列表list
列表是Python中最常用的数据结构之一,它可以作为一个方括号内的逗号分隔值出现。列表中的每个元素可以是任何类型,包括其他列表。列表是可变的,意味着你可以在创建后修改它的内容。
list1=[1,2,3,4,5]
2、元组tuple
元组与列表类似,不同之处在于元组是不可变的。这意味着一旦创建,你不能更改元组中的元素。元组通常用于保存不希望被修改的数据。
tuple1=(1,2,3,4,5)
3、集合set
集合是一个无序的不重复元素序列。集合中的元素必须是可hash的,也就是说不可变的。集合可以用来去重,并做关系运算。
set1={1,2,3,4,5}
4、字典dict
字典是一种哈希表型的数据结构,字典中的元素是通过键来存取的,而不是通过偏移量。字典是可变的,也就是说可以添加、修改和删除元素。
dict1={'name':'John','age':30,'city':'New York'}